#048297 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#048297 is composed of 1.6% red, 51%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.4% cyan, 13.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 188.6 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 30.4%. #048297 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#00052f.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#048297

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000f11 is the darkest color, while #fdff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#048297

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4f4f is the less saturated color, while #048297 is the most saturated one.
